CNB Financial Corporation reported second quarter 2026 net income of $27.2 million, or $0.91 per diluted share, compared to $26.0 million ($0.88 per share) in Q1 2026 and $12.9 million ($0.61 per share) in Q2 2025. Total loans were $6.4 billion and total deposits were $7.1 billion as of June 30, 2026. On June 15, 2026, the company completed a $50.0 million partial redemption of its 3.25% Fixed-to-Floating Rate Subordinated Notes, leaving $35.0 million outstanding. Net interest margin was 3.88% for the quarter. The company also noted the one-year anniversary of its acquisition of ESSA Bancorp, Inc. on July 23, 2025. The company is a financial holding company that operates CNB Bank, providing full-service banking, trust, and wealth management services.

CNB Financial Corporation's Board of Directors approved the 2026 Common Share Repurchase Program, authorizing the company to repurchase up to 500,000 shares of common stock for an aggregate purchase price not exceeding $15,000,000. The program is authorized to run from June 10, 2026, through June 10, 2027. CNB Financial Corporation is a financial services company providing banking and investment services.
